Abstract

Official abstract text for this publication.

A bone fixation assembly can include a suture button, a bone plate, and a suture assembly. The suture button can include a body that has a first end surface, a second end surface, and a circumferential outer surface. A first pair of passages can be formed through the body from the first end surface to the second end surface. The circumferential outer surface can include at least one protrusion or retaining rib extending radially therefrom. The bone plate defines an aperture. The suture button is configured to be at least partially received into the aperture in an assembled position such that the retaining rib engages the bone plate and inhibits withdrawal of the suture button from the aperture in the assembled position. The suture assembly includes a suture engaging member and a suture configured to couple the suture engaging member in the suture button.

First claim

Opening claim text (preview).

What is claimed is: 1. A bone fixation system comprising: a suture button having a body that includes a first end surface, a second end surface, a circumferential outer surface, and a first pair of passages formed through the body from the first end surface to the second end surface, the circumferential outer surface including at least one protrusion extending radially therefrom; a bone plate that defines an aperture configured to at least partially receive the suture button and to engage the at least one protrusion; a suture engaging member including an elongated member having a flexible tube defining a passage therethrough, the elongated member configured to expand and engage a bone; and a suture configured to be looped through the passage in the suture engaging member and to couple the suture engaging member and the suture button. 2. The bone fixation system of claim 1 , wherein the suture button further defines a second pair of passages formed through the body from the first end surface to the second end surface. 3. The bone fixation system of claim 2 , wherein the body defines a pair of radial openings that connect the second pair of passages, respectively with the circumferential outer surface. 4. The bone fixation system of claim 2 , wherein the body further defines a central passage, the first pair and the second pair of passages located radially outwardly on the body relative to the central passage. 5. The bone fixation system of claim 1 , wherein the body has an upper portion that has a first diameter and a lower portion that has a second diameter, wherein the first diameter is larger than the second diameter and the at least one protrusion is formed on the lower portion. 6. The bone fixation system of claim 1 , wherein each passage of the first pair of passages defines a passage axis, the passage axes tapering toward each other from the first end surface to the second end surface. 7. The bone fixation system of claim 1 , wherein a lower portion of the body is configured to be received into the aperture of the bone plate and an upper portion of the body is configured to extend proud from the bone plate in an assembled configuration. 8. The bone fixation system of claim 1 , wherein each passage of the first pair of passages is further defined by a chamfer surface that connects the first end surface with a sidewall of the passage. 9. The bone fixation system of claim 1 , wherein the aperture comprises a threaded portion and the at least one protrusion comprises a first retaining rib and a second retaining rib, disposed at least partially below the first retaining rib, the first and second retaining ribs configured to engage the threaded portion. 10. A bone fixation system comprising: a suture button having a body that includes a first end surface, a second end surface, a circumferential outer surface, a central passage formed through the body from the first end surface to the second end surface, and a first pair of passages formed through the body from the first end surface to the second end surface, the first pair of passages located radially outwardly relative to the central passage, the circumferential outer surface including at least two pairs of discontinuous retaining ribs extending radially therefrom; and a bone plate defining a plurality of threaded apertures, the suture button configured to be at least partially received into a select one of the plurality of threaded apertures in an assembled configuration, wherein the at least two pairs of discontinuous retaining ribs are configured to engage the threads of the select one of the plurality of threaded apertures and inhibit withdrawal of the suture button from the select one of the plurality of threaded apertures in the assembled configuration. 11. The bone fixation system of claim 10 , wherein the suture button further defines a second pair of passages formed through the body from the first end surface to the second end surface. 12. The bone fixation system of claim 10 , wherein the body defines a pair of radial openings that connect the second pair of passages, respectively with the circumferential outer surface. 13. The bone fixation system of claim 10 , wherein the body has an upper portion that has a first diameter and a lower portion that has a second diameter, wherein the first diameter is larger than the second diameter and at least one pair of the at least two pairs of retaining ribs is formed on the lower portion. 14. The bone fixation system of claim 10 , wherein the first pair of passages taper toward each other from the first end surface to the second end surface. 15. The bone fixation system of claim 10 , wherein a lower portion of the body is configured to be received into the select one of the plurality of threaded apertures and an upper portion of the body is configured to extend proud from an outer surface of the bone plate in an assembled configuration. 16. A bone fixation system comprising: a suture button having a body that includes a first end surface, a second end surface, a circumferential outer surface, and a first pair of passages formed through the body, each passage of the first pair of passages defining a passage axis, the passage axes extending toward each other from the first end surface to the second end surface, the circumferential outer surface including at least one protrusion extending radially therefrom; a bone plate that defines an aperture configured to be at least partially receive the at least one protrusion; a suture engaging member; and a suture configured to couple the suture engaging member and the suture button. 17. The bone fixation system of claim 16 , wherein the body defines a wall, extending from the first end surface to the second end surface, the wall separating each passage of the first pair of passages. 18. The bone fixation system of claim 16 , wherein the aperture comprises a threaded portion configured to engage the at least one protrusion. 19. The bone fixation system of claim 16 , wherein the suture button further defines a second pair of passages formed through the body and extending from the first end surface to the second end surface. 20. The bone fixation system of claim 16 , wherein each passage of the first pair of passages is further defined by a chamfer surface that connects the first end surface with a sidewall of the passage.
